The theory developed originally by Benoit to study the static scatteri
ng properties of multicomponent neutral polymer mixtures is extended h
ere to polyelectrolytes mixtures. Applications of this formalism to ca
ses of practical interest are presented. The case of a ternary mixture
made of a polyelectrolyte, a neutral polymer and a solvent is conside
red. The effects of the neutral polymer on the scattering peak of the
polyelectrolyte are discussed. This formalism is also used to analyze
the recent neutron scattering data from mixtures of polystyrenesulfona
te and tetramethylammonium in aqueous solutions reported by Van der Ma
arel et al. A good agreement between the data and the theoretical pred
ictions is obtained for the polyion-polyion structure factor in the wh
ole range of the wavevectors covered in these experiments.
